I’m in the sixth week of my internship at Brigham and Women’s Hospital, a 793-bed affiliate of Harvard Medical School. Its association with Harvard has consistently made it one of the highest-ranked hospitals in the country, and the U.S. News and World Report in 2016 ranked it the 13th best hospital in America. The Brigham is always searching to improve healthcare in Boston. It is associated with the Dana Farber Cancer Institute and founded Partners Healthcare, the largest healthcare provider in Massachusetts, in partnership with Massachusetts General Hospital.

I’ve been working in Physician Assistant (PA) Services on numerous projects, and I have been learning just how important PAs and other Advanced Practice Providers (APPs) really are in this time of physician shortages. My preceptor is one of the most ambitious people I’ve ever met, yet she is so supportive and open to granting me independence while I work on my projects.
I work out of three different locations in Boston for my projects, which gives me the ability to meet a wide variety of people working in healthcare. First, I’ve worked on standardizing the credentialing and privileging process so that by the end of my internship, each department will have the same form and process for PAs. Next, I’ve started to create an Interdisciplinary Practice Committee, which will involve the directors of PAs, nurse practitioners, other APPs, chief physicians, and the CEO. Finally, while I can’t go into details at this time, I’ve also been tasked with an innovative project related to PAs that will be the first of its kind in the country.
